Rare Oceansaway17 Posted September 19, 2021 #1719 Share Posted September 19, 2021 23 hours ago, Jim_Iain said: On Equinox, Celebrity has rally been good with their staff. They have been doing curated bubble excursions for staff to beaches and the crew have really enjoyed the time off the ship. I believe it is both nationality and position dependent with a sign up for a limited number of slots. No photo ops with Captain and Crew but the Senior Staff is out and about and very approachable. good to know.
